pg토토 결과는 토토 결과 패키지입니다 인터페이스 할 클라이언트 프로그램PostgreSQL서버. 그것은 대부분을 만듭니다 의 기능성libpq사용 가능 토토 결과 스크립트에.
표 29-1|pg토토 결과. 이 명령은 설명되어 있습니다 후속 페이지에 추가.
표 29-1.pg토토 결과명령
10397_10406 | 설명 |
---|---|
pg_connect |
서버 연결 열기 |
PG_DISCONNECT |
서버 연결 닫기 |
pg_conndefaults |
연결 옵션 및 기본값 가져 오기 |
pg_exec |
서버로 명령 보내기 |
pg_result |
명령 결과에 대한 정보 얻기 |
pg_select |
쿼리 결과에 대한 루프 |
pg_execute |
쿼리를 보내고 선택적으로 루프를 통해 결과 |
pg_listen |
비동기식 콜백을 설정하거나 변경합니다 알림 메시지 |
PG_ON_CONNECTION_LOSS |
예기치 않은 연결을 위해 콜백을 설정하거나 변경합니다 손실 |
pg_lo_creat |
큰 개체 생성 |
PG_LO_OPEN |
큰 개체 열기 |
PG_LO_CLOSE |
큰 물체를 닫습니다 |
PG_LO_READ |
큰 개체에서 읽기 |
PG_LO_WRITE |
큰 물체에 쓰기 |
PG_LO_LSEEK |
큰 물체의 위치를 찾으십시오 |
PG_LO_TELL |
대형의 현재 탐색 위치를 반환합니다 물체 |
PG_LO_UNLINK |
큰 개체 삭제 |
pg_lo_import |
파일에서 큰 개체 가져 오기 |
pg_lo_export |
큰 객체를 파일로 내보내십시오 |
thePG_LO_*
명령은입니다
의 큰 객체 기능에 대한 인터페이스PostgreSQL.함수는 그것을 모방하도록 설계되었습니다
표준 UNIX 파일에서 유사한 파일 시스템 기능
시스템 인터페이스. 그만큼PG_LO_*
명령은 a를 사용해야합니다.시작/커밋디스크립터가 반환했기 때문에 트랜잭션 블록PG_LO_OPEN
현재 거래.pg_lo_import
andpg_lo_export
필수a시작/커밋트랜잭션 블록.